It was more of an introduction to mental health first aid\u2014not to be used as a replacement for the eight-hour youth mental health first aid program\u2014but informational and insightful nonetheless. We played some true or false trivia which covered the basic facts and statistics about mental health conditions. The trivia set the scene for what was to come. It gave a simple overview of the topic to get us into the mood so we could delve deeper and discuss more intimately about specifics. Dr. Milam displayed a slideshow presentation and carried us through more particular mental health conditions, like Depression, Bipolar Disorder, Psychosis, and more, educating us about common symptoms and how we could help. At the end, he put up a written example scenario of a girl going through possible mental health struggles and asked us to brainstorm ideas on how we would assist and support her. \u00a0<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400\">Overall, I found this workshop captivating and helpful. Although a licensed professional (and not a teenaged girl) needs to diagnose mental health conditions, I now know more than the basic &#8220;Depression is terrible sadness&#8221; and that some common stereotypes, such as Bipolar Disorder being a mood difference between happy and sad, are only misconceptions.
